Venezuela’s Decision to Resume Migrant flights: Understanding the Context

venezuela’s recent decision to allow the resumption of migrant flights from the United States signals a significant shift in its approach to foreign relations and migration policy. This move comes amid a backdrop of ongoing challenges within the country, wich has been grappling with an economic crisis, widespread humanitarian issues, and a massive outflow of citizens seeking better opportunities abroad. The re-opening of these flight pathways could provide a lifeline for many Venezuelans stranded in precarious situations, and also a gesture of goodwill towards the U.S. amid deteriorating diplomatic relations.

Several factors contributed to this pivotal decision:

  • Humanitarian Concerns: With millions of Venezuelans living in challenging conditions abroad,the desire to address thier plight has compelled the government to take a more inclusive approach.
  • Political Strategy: By engaging with the U.S., Venezuela may be attempting to soften its image and foster dialog, particularly amidst ongoing investigations into intelligence leaks that might implicate government officials.
  • Repercussions from Sanctions: The economic sanctions imposed by the U.S. have further isolated the Venezuelan economy, making it essential for the government to explore avenues for relief and negotiation.

the current situation also intersects with investigations by the Department of Justice (DOJ) regarding potential leaks of intelligence related to gang activities in Venezuela. As the U.S. grapples with internal security concerns tied to these gangs, the re-establishment of migrant flights is not only about humanitarian relief but also about improving bilateral relationships that have been strained by distrust. The effective management of migration and security issues could benefit both nations if approached collaboratively.
